## Data Stores — Quillfinch Nightly Reindex

The nightly search reindex for Quillfinch runs at 02:10 and rebuilds the full document index from the canonical catalog database, not from the search cluster itself. Release managers should avoid deploying schema changes between 02:00 and 03:30, since a mid-reindex migration leaves the index partially stale until the next run. Reindex progress is tracked in the `reindex_runs` table. The job reads from the catalog primary using the following connection:

primary connection of yagep-kahip = redis://giliel_svc:zYiKsLL2PLpfPL@db-348f.xolmarsys.corp:5432/fenwyn

## Formula sandbox tuning

User-supplied formulas in Gridmoor execute inside a restricted interpreter with hard ceilings on time, memory, and call depth. Reviewers should confirm any change to these ceilings is justified in the PR description, since raising them widens the abuse surface. Defaults were chosen from production traces. The current limits are as follows.

limits module of tafog-fawip:
WEIGHTS = {
    "julix": 57,
    "lamys": 992,
    "kasvan": 209,
    "quenok": 750,
    "alddor": 259,
    "oliath": 1009,
    "wenix": 815,
}

Quick note for the security review on the Hollowpine cron drift thing: our vendor, Tickwright Systems, confirmed their scheduler nodes were syncing against a stale NTP pool, which is why nightly export jobs slid up to four minutes late. They've repointed the fleet and added drift alarms at 30 seconds. No evidence of tampering — just sloppy config. We're asking for their remediation write-up anyway. If you want the raw logs, request them here.

escalation mailbox, yajeg-bageg: quenax.olidor@lumiccorp.internal